SOIL BORING ADVANCEMENT AND SAMPLING <br /> AGI proposes to advance ten (10) soil borings at the site utilizing a truck-mounted <br /> Geoprobe 5400 direct-push probing unit equipped with 1 .45-inch diameter probing rods. <br /> The Geoprobe advances soil probe borings using a hydraulic hammer to drive sampling <br /> tools to specified depths. Soil Samples will be collected at 5-foot intervals bsg to total <br /> depth. Grab groundwater samples will be collected from three undetermined borings. <br /> Upon reaching total depth, all proposed soil sampling borings will be converted into dual- <br /> completed soil-vapor sampling points. Soil-vapor sampling points will be installed at <br /> depths of 5 and 15 feet bsg. All soil-vapor samples will be collected with Summa (vacuum) <br /> canisters. <br /> Soil samples will be collected at selected depths from each boring using a 1.45-inch <br /> Geoprobe soil sampling assembly. Field screening of soil samples shall be performed <br /> using an organic vapor meter (OVM), equipped with photo-ionization detector (PID) pre- <br /> calibrated to isobutylene. <br /> 2.3. SOIL, GROUNDWATER, AND SOIL-VAPOR LABORATORY ANALYSIS <br /> Selected soil, groundwater, and soil-vapor samples may be submitted to an appropriately <br /> certified laboratory for analysis. Analysis shall be performed at the sole discretion of AGI. <br /> 2.4. BORING ABANDONMENT <br /> All soil borings will be permanently sealed to prevent vertical migration of potential <br /> contaminants. Soil borings shall be abandoned by backfilling with cement grout from the <br /> total depth to surface grade. The top three to six inches of the boring abandonments will <br /> be completed flush to surface grade with concrete or native material. The EHD will be <br /> notified for grout inspection at least 48 hours prior to conducting grouting procedures. <br /> 2.5. EQUIPMENT DECONTAMINATION/WASTE MANAGEMENT <br /> All sampling tools used for sample collection will be thoroughly rinsed with clean water <br /> after being washed with a solution of Alconox. All probing rods will be cleaned prior to <br /> advancement at each probe boring location. Any soil or water waste generated during <br /> field activities will be containerized in properly labeled DOT-approved drums and stored <br /> on-site in an area generally lacking public access. Disposal alternatives will be evaluated <br /> based on results of soil and/or water analysis.
